Mass of Saint Gregory the Great (Christian iconography)

Note: Miraculous appearance of Christ as the Man of Sorrows appears on the altar as St. Gregory says mass, in response to Gregory's prayers to convince a doubter of transubstantiation (the changing of bread and wine to the body and blood of Christ).
